Summary

The Boston Celtics traded Jaylen Brown to the Philadelphia 76ers, seeking a new direction for their franchise. ESPN's Shams Charania reports that the Celtics doubted Brown and Jayson Tatum could continue their successful partnership. This move reflects broader issues around player roles and hierarchy within the team. The Celtics may look to acquire Paul George and additional draft capital, suggesting further changes are on the horizon.
